The Tay Road Bridge has closed to high-sided vehicles and is only open to cars.
Winds over 70mph have forced bridge chiefs to make the move as a safety precaution. The central reservation, used by cyclists and pedestrians, has also been closed.
Should the gusts exceed 80mph, the bridge will then be closed to all traffic.
Dundee and Tayside has been placed under a severe weather warning with gales set to batter the area over night.

Heavy rain is also expected and the Met Office has warned there may be disruption to travel.
A tweet from the Tay Road Bridge Twitter account mistakenly stated the bridge was closed to all vehicles but that is not the case a spokesman confirmed to the Tele.
